As part of the RBC Emerging Artists Playwright Mentorship program, APN is proud to present a conversation with award-winning playwright/screenwriter Charles Netto and award-winning producer/director/actor Jayson Therrien.

Both of these artists started their careers in Calgary and have a wealth of information to share about the creative, production and business sides of making film and television.

Charles Netto is an award-winning screenwriter as well as director and producer of narrative film hailing from Mohkinsstsis on Treaty 7 territory. In 2015 Netto co-wrote the award winning film One Night in Aberdeen (available on shortoftheweek.com), premiered at the Calgary International Film Festival where it won Best Overall Short and the Enbridge Alberta Spirit Award.

Jayson Therrien has been a part of the film industry in Canada for over 15 years, serving first as an actor then a producer and now director. Acting credits include: Jann (CTV), Black Summer (Netflix), Tribal (ATPN), Everfall (ShowTime Networks), A Miracle on Christmas Lake (SONY), Fargo (FX), Heartland (CBC).
